How they compare
Nicaragua currently reports 4,626 US dollar per square kilometre against 4,580 US dollar per square kilometre in Uganda, a difference of 46 US dollar per square kilometre.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Uganda ahead.
Nicaragua ranks 117th and Uganda ranks 118th of 165 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Nicaragua averaged higher in 1 and Uganda in 2.

About this data
Other investment, Currency and deposits, Deposit taking corporations, except the Central Bank (Assets, Positions, US dollar)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
